60changelog.ldif 2.6 KB

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364656667686970717273747576777879808182838485868788899091929394
  1. # 60changelog.ldif - From draft-good-ldap-changelog-03
  2. ################################################################################
  3. #
  4. dn: cn=schema
  5. #
  6. ################################################################################
  7. #
  8. attributeTypes: (
  9. 2.16.840.1.113730.3.1.5
  10. NAME 'changeNumber'
  11. DESC 'a number which uniquely identifies a change made to a directory entry'
  12. EQUALITY integerMatch
  13. ORDERING integerOrderingMatch
  14. SYNTAX 1.3.6.1.4.1.1466.115.121.1.27
  15. SINGLE-VALUE
  16. )
  17. #
  18. ################################################################################
  19. #
  20. attributeTypes: (
  21. 2.16.840.1.113730.3.1.6
  22. NAME 'targetDN'
  23. DESC 'the DN of the entry which was modified'
  24. EQUALITY distinguishedNameMatch
  25. SYNTAX 1.3.6.1.4.1.1466.115.121.1.12
  26. SINGLE-VALUE
  27. )
  28. #
  29. ################################################################################
  30. #
  31. attributeTypes: (
  32. 2.16.840.1.113730.3.1.7
  33. NAME 'changeType'
  34. DESC 'the type of change made to an entry'
  35. EQUALITY caseIgnoreMatch
  36. SYNTAX 1.3.6.1.4.1.1466.115.121.1.15
  37. SINGLE-VALUE
  38. )
  39. #
  40. ################################################################################
  41. #
  42. attributeTypes: (
  43. 2.16.840.1.113730.3.1.8
  44. NAME 'changes'
  45. DESC 'a set of changes to apply to an entry'
  46. SYNTAX 1.3.6.1.4.1.1466.115.121.1.40
  47. )
  48. #
  49. ################################################################################
  50. #
  51. attributeTypes: (
  52. 2.16.840.1.113730.3.1.9
  53. NAME 'newRDN'
  54. DESC 'the new RDN of an entry which is the target of a modrdn operation'
  55. EQUALITY distinguishedNameMatch
  56. SYNTAX 1.3.6.1.4.1.1466.115.121.1.12
  57. SINGLE-VALUE
  58. )
  59. #
  60. ################################################################################
  61. #
  62. attributeTypes: (
  63. 2.16.840.1.113730.3.1.10
  64. NAME 'deleteOldRDN'
  65. DESC 'a flag which indicates if the old RDN should be retained as an attribute of the entry'
  66. EQUALITY booleanMatch
  67. SYNTAX 1.3.6.1.4.1.1466.115.121.1.7
  68. SINGLE-VALUE
  69. )
  70. #
  71. ################################################################################
  72. #
  73. attributeTypes: (
  74. 2.16.840.1.113730.3.1.11
  75. NAME 'newSuperior'
  76. DESC 'the new parent of an entry which is the target of a moddn operation'
  77. EQUALITY distinguishedNameMatch
  78. SYNTAX 1.3.6.1.4.1.1466.115.121.1.12
  79. SINGLE-VALUE
  80. )
  81. #
  82. ################################################################################
  83. #
  84. objectClasses: (
  85. 2.16.840.1.113730.3.2.1
  86. NAME 'changeLogEntry'
  87. SUP top
  88. STRUCTURAL
  89. MUST ( changeNumber $ targetDN $ changeType )
  90. MAY ( changes $ newRDN $ deleteOldRDN $ newSuperior )
  91. )
  92. #
  93. ################################################################################
  94. #